We invite papers describing original work in a number of technical areas related to field and service robotics, including, for example: * Mining, Agriculture, and Forestry Robotics * Construction Robots * Search and Rescue Robotics * Cleaning, Floor, and Lawn Care Robotics * Security Robotics * Medical and Health Care Robotics * Entertainment * Autonomous Vehicles for Land, Air, and Sea * Intelligent Automobiles
